About 20 Christopher Close

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

20 Christopher Close is a three-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Salisbury (SP2 8QT). It has a recorded floor area of 70 m² (around 753 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1991-1995 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(August 2025) shows a C (score 75), near the top of the C band. The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since September 2009.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Good, window ef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 81). The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.

It hasn't traded since April 2002, a hold of 24 years that's notably long for the area. Across 1995–2002, sale prices on this property compounded at 11.2%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£315,000 sits 110% above the 2002 sale of £150,000. At 70 m² it's 25% larger than the typical home in the postcode (56 m² median across 15 EPCs).
